RoC to take SEBI help in Satyam probe

The Economic Offences Court here has allowed Registrar of Companies to take market regulator SEBI's help in its probe into Satyam's affairs. RoC had sought permission from the court to "search and seize" the books of accounts, papers including electronic record of Satyam Computer at its registered office here and other possible places.

Giving its permission for the search and seizure operation, the judge also allowed the RoC Hyderabad to take assistance of the officials of SEBI for conducting the search. In its petition, RoC also sought permission to retain seized material, restrain any damage to them, and also seek the police help in the operation.

RoC said that Satyam appeared to have committed "serious irregularities by showing artificial and inflated profits for the last several years and thereby projecting the fictitious figures and facts in the balance sheets attracting the violations of the Companies Act, 1956, SEBI Act 1992 etc."
